The Enterprise Risk Management Lead supports the company's Enterprise Risk Management (ERM) framework by executing core risk oversight activities across business lines and support functions.
The role requires a high standard of professional competence, integrity, independence of judgment, and regulatory awareness, consistent with the Fitness & Probity Standards applicable to Controlled Functions.
Foundational ORM processes, including Risk and Control Self-Assessments (RCSAs), control design and operating effectiveness assessments, operational incident management, and Second Line of Defense (2LOD) control testing will also be required.
The role partners closely with First Line of Defense (1LOD) stakeholders to promote a strong risk culture, ensure consistent application of the ORM framework, and support regulatory expectations applicable to Irish and EMEA-regulated entities.
Responsibilities
Act with honesty, integrity, and ethical conduct, consistent with the Central Bank of Ireland's Fitness & Probity Standards
Demonstrate and maintain competence and capability appropriate to the role, including ongoing professional development
Comply with internal policies, regulatory requirements, and applicable Conduct Standards
Participate in the firm's Fitness & Probity certification process and confirm ongoing compliance on a periodic basis
Promptly disclose any matter that could impact their fitness or probity status, in line with regulatory expectations
Support the execution of periodic RCSAs across assigned business lines and functions, including risk identification, control mapping, and residual risk assessment
Review and challenge risk statements, inherent risk ratings, control descriptions, and control effectiveness assessments for completeness and consistency
Assist with documentation, quality assurance, and consolidation of RCSA results for reporting and governance forums
Perform 2LOD control testing for in-scope key controls, including design effectiveness and operating effectiveness testing, in line with established ORM procedures
Escalate material risk issues, control weaknesses, or inconsistencies to the PCF-14 in a timely and transparent manner
Execute control testing using appropriate methods (e.g., inquiry, inspection, observation, re-performance) and defined sample sizes
Document testing results, identify control gaps or weaknesses, and support issue validation and escalation
Support the operational incident and loss event process, including event intake, classification, root cause analysis, and impact assessment
Monitor incident remediation actions and follow up with control owners to ensure timely closure
Assist with trend analysis and thematic reporting of incidents and control issues
Prepare inputs for operational risk reporting, dashboards, and governance materials
Partner with 1LOD stakeholders to provide guidance on ORM expectations, control standards, and documentation practices
Support audits, regulatory exams, and internal reviews by providing ORM documentation and analysis as required
Support the PCF-14 and ORM leadership in responding to internal audit, regulatory requests, and supervisory engagements with the Central Bank of Ireland
Qualifications
Solid understanding of operational risk concepts, risk and control frameworks, and the Three Lines of Defense model
Experience assessing control design and operating effectiveness
Familiarity with GRC tools, risk systems, or structured risk documentation processes is a plus
Strong attention to detail and documentation discipline
Clear written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to challenge constructively
Ability to manage multiple workstreams and meet deadlines
Collaborative mindset with the confidence to engage with senior stakeholders
Education / Certification Requirements:
Bachelor's degree in Risk Management, Finance, Accounting, Business, Economics, or a related discipline
Experience
5-10 years' experience in operational risk, enterprise risk, compliance, internal audit, or a related control function within a regulated financial services environment
Practical experience supporting RCSAs, control assessments, incident management, or 2LOD oversight
